引起APPLICATION FAILED TO START的错误

菜鸟在学习过程中总是会遇到很多奇葩性的问题,比如我遇到的更多。。。。

今天在做项目的时候,运行项目的时候,启动不起来,遇到了如下的错误

引起APPLICATION FAILED TO START的错误_第1张图片

作为菜鸟的我,看到错误往往都是一脸懵逼的。

对应到相应的这个Consumption实体类里看了半天,觉得理论上应该不会有什么问题的。真是坑啊,在实体类中多加了一个

@Repository的注解。很疑惑为什么写demo的时候,这么二百五的写出来,可以正常启动。

在项目中还遇到这样的错误

Field positionDao in com.yd.lipstick.service.LipstickService required a bean of type 'com.yd.lipstick.dao.read.PositionDao' that could not be found.

查看了项目的所有配置,和注解的引入,觉得都没问题,唯一觉得怪异的地方就是有两个在不同文件夹下的dao名是一样的。如下图:

引起APPLICATION FAILED TO START的错误_第2张图片

修改名称之后,如下图引起APPLICATION FAILED TO START的错误_第3张图片

这样就把如上的运行失败的问题解决了。

你可能感兴趣的:(Java)